His journal is probably the biggest reason that we now have thousands of semiprofessional and professional players who multitable the internet games. When he first starting writing about it, there were only a few people doing this.

In early 2003, he was absolutely destroying the Party 3/6 games while playing a very weak/tight strategy. Of course, the games have gotten much tougher at all limits since then.
